COURTESY In our letters, we should always keep in mind the person we are writing to, see things from his angle, visualize him in his surroundings, see his problems and difficulties and express ideas in terms of his experience.,B. CORRECTNESS Correct grammar, punctuation and spelling are basic requirements for business letter writing. Also, we should choose the correct level of language and use accurate information and data in our letters.,Unit One Introduction to Business Letters (商务信函概论),Criteria for Business Letters,C. CLARITY We should first identify what we want to express and then express the idea in plain, simple words and formats.,D. COMPLETENESS Our letters should include all the necessary information and data.,E. CONCISENESS We should write in the fewest possible words without sacrificing completeness and courtesy.,F. CONCRETENESS Our writing should be vivid, specific and definite.,Unit One Introduction to Business Letters (商务信函概论),The General Procedures for Business Letter Writing:,1. Determine our purpose of writing a certain letter.,2. Identify who the readers are.,3. Organize the message, which is to be contained in the letter.,4. Write a draft.,5. Yours faithfully.,Unit Two Establishing Business Relations(建立贸易关系),Unit Three Inquiries (询盘),Objectives,Introduction,New Words & Expressions,Chinese Version of the Text,Keys to Exercises,Objectives,Unit Three Inquiries(询盘),通过本章的学习,帮助学生掌握: 询盘的定义及种类 询盘信函的撰写 询盘信函中常用的专业词汇及句型,Introduction,An inquiry is a request for information. In the international business the importer may send an inquiry to an exporter, inviting a quotation and or an offer for the goods he wishes to buy or simply asking for some general information about these goods.,Definition of an inquiry:,Unit Three Inquiries(询盘),Introduction,In a General Inquiry (一般询价), the importer may ask only for catalogues, price lists, samples, sample books, or quotations, etc., in order to get a general idea of the business scope of the exporter. In a Specific Inquiry(具体询价), the importer points out what products he needs and asks for a quotation or an offer for this item.,Generally speaking, inquiries fall into two categories: a General Inquiry and a Specific Inquiry.,Unit Three Inquiries(询盘),Introduction,1. State the source of the information and make a self-introduction at the beginning of the letter. 2. State the purpose of writing the letter. For example, the writer may explain to the recipient what he wants, give a description or specification of the goods he requires or express his willingness to enter into business relations with the recipient, etc 3.
